Who was Jaswant Singh Khalra?

Jaswant Singh Khalra was a Sikh human rights activist from Punjab. He became widely popular for revealing alleged extrajudicial killings and secret cremations. He primarily campaigned against disappearances and advocated for the truth about missing people.
Khalra reportedly went through the official documents of the mass killings and came across several pieces of evidence that many unidentified bodies were cremated in Punjab without proper identification. His conclusions suggested a disturbing trend of violence and secrecy. These were widely reported by human rights organizations and the media.

About Satluj

Satluj, earlier called Punjab ’95, is based on the life and struggle of Khalra. The movie, which is directed by Honey Trehan and stars Diljit Dosanjh. This movie shows an individual who rebelled against a society, which many felt was created to suppress “uncomfortable truths”.
Why was it removed?
The problem with this dispute is that Satluj is bound to a true human rights case. The story of Jaswant Singh Khalra is not only political, but also deeply personal and tragic since he was abducted in 1995 and has not been released alive. The ban has also sparked a larger debate over freedom of expression in movies. The movie is not only a form of entertainment, but a way for many viewers to remember.

Why Khalra’s Legacy Still Matters?
The work of Jaswant Singh Khalra is still relevant as it addresses the issue of accountability, justice, and questioning the hard questions. He has been remembered as a person who did not turn a blind eye to suffering, even when that meant putting himself in harm’s way. Hence, his story still reverberates even after decades, and make to the big screen as Satluj.
